How they compare
Mali currently reports 0.0191 % change on previous year against 0 % change on previous year in Nicaragua, a difference of 0.0191 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 14 times across 23 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Mali ahead.
Mali ranks 85th and Nicaragua ranks 86th of 185 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Mali averaged higher in 1 and Nicaragua in 3.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Wood pulp — Import quantity.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
